The existence of $n$ positive solutions is established for second-order multi-point boundary value problem at resonance where $n$ is an arbitrary natural number. The proof is based on a theory of fixed point index for A-proper semilinear operators defined on cones due to Cremins.
Keywords: boundary value problem, positive solution, resonance, A-proper, fixed point index
